Frome has had a thriving
market since the time of The Domesday Book, and today regular markets still take place, with general markets every Wednesday and Saturday. Check out Frome Country Market for local produce, plants, crafts and art every Thursday in the Cheese and Grain. The Frome Collectors and Flea Market is every Wednesday, where you can hunt for quality second-hand goods, antiques and collectables.
Wander through Frome’s Artisan Quarter - the narrow cobbled streets of Catherine Hill, Palmer Street, Paul Street, Stony Street and the lower part of Catherine Street. Here you’ll find classic gifts, stylish clothes and accessories, ceramics, haberdashery, vintage clothes, and great cafés and restaurants.
Cheap Street, off Market Place, is one of Frome’s prettiest, with a leat running down the middle that carries water from the stream beneath St John’s Church.

The George Inn at Norton St Philip was built in the 14th or 15th century and claims to be Britain’s oldest tavern, although it has rivals. Originally built as a wool store for the Carthusian Hinton Priory at nearby Hinton
Charterhouse, it’s thought to have got a licence to sell alcohol from 1397. The timber-framed upper floors were added in the 15th century.
Popular today, it serves a good range of beers and excellent food.

The priory at Hinton Charterhouse was one of originally twelve Carthusian
priories in England. Carthusian monks led a life of contemplation with the emphasis on solitude and silence.
The priory was closed on 31 March 1539, part of Henry VIII’s dissolution of the monasteries.

Midford once had two railway lines running through it, the famous Somerset & Dorset between Bath and
Bournemouth and a branch line from Limpley Stoke to Camerton, both now long closed.
The 1953 Ealing Comedy film, The Titfield Thunderbolt, opens with an express speeding
over the viaduct on the Somerset & Dorset while the branch line train chuffs away underneath.
